| 1 | 针刺临床试验干预措施报告标准修订版:CONSORT声明的扩展显示文摘'针刺临床试验干预措施报告标准'(Standards,for Reporting Interventions in Clinical Trials of Acupuncture,STRICTA)于2001年和2002年在5种期刊上发表。该指南以对照试验检查清单及解释的形式供作者和期刊编辑使用,旨在提高针刺临床试验报告的质量,尤其是对其中干预措施的报告,因而有助于对这些试验的解释和重复。随后对STRICTA的应用及影响的述评都强调了STRICTA的价值,也提出了改进和修订的建议。为使修订过程顺利进地,STRICTA工作组、CONSORT工作组和中国Cochrane中心于2008年开始合作,召集成立的包含47名成员的专家小组对清单的修改稿提出了电子版反馈意见。在后来于弗莱堡(Freiburg)召开的见面会上,由21名专家组成的工作组进一步修订了STRICTA对照检查清单,并计划如何对其进行发布。新的STRICTA对照检查清单作为CONSORT的正式扩展版,包含6项条目及17条二级条目。这些条目为报告针刺治疗的合理性、针刺的细节、治疗方案、其他干预措施、治疗师的背景以及对照或对照干预提供了指南。而且,作为修订工作的一部分,对每一条目作了详尽解释,并针对每一条目给出了良好报告的实例。此外,STRICTA中的'对照'(controlled)一词被替换成了'临床'(clinical),以示STRICTA适用于更广泛的各类临床评价设计,包括非对照结局研究和病例报道。修订的STRICTA对照检查清单有望与CONSORT声明及其非药物治疗扩展版一起共同提高针刺临床试验的报告质量。 | Hugh MacPherson Douglas G.Altman Richard Hammerschlag 李幼平 吴泰相 Adrian White David Moher 代表STRICTA修订版工作组 刘建平 | 2010 | 中国循证医学杂志2010,10,10: | 126 |

| 5 | DMP1 prevents osteocyte alterations,FGF23 elevation and left ventricular hypertrophy in mice with chronic kidney disease显示文摘During chronic kidney disease (CKD),alterations in bone and mineral metabolism include increased production of the hormone fibroblast growth factor 23 (FGF23) that may contribute to cardiovascular mortality.The osteocyte protein dentin matrix protein 1 (DMP1) reduces FGF23 and enhances bone mineralization,but its effects in CKD are unknown.We tested the hypothesis that DMP1 supplementation in CKD would improve bone health,prevent FGF23 elevations and minimize consequent adverse cardiovascular outcomes.We investigated DMP1 regulation and effects in wild-type (WT) mice and the Col4a3^-/- mouse model of CKD.Col4a3^-/- mice demonstrated impaired kidney function,reduced bone DMP1 expression,reduced bone mass,altered osteocyte morphology and connectivity,increased osteocyte apoptosis,increased serum FGF23,hyperphosphatemia,left ventricular hypertrophy (LVH),and reduced survival.Genetic or pharmacological supplementation of DMP1 in Col4a3^-/- mice prevented osteocyte apoptosis,preserved osteocyte networks,corrected bone mass,partially lowered FGF23 levels by attenuating NFAT-induced FGF23 transcription,and further increased serum phosphate.Despite impaired kidney function and worsened hyperphosphatemia,DMP1 prevented development of LVH and improved Col4a3^-/- survival.Our data suggest that CKD reduces DMP1 expression,whereas its restoration represents a potential therapeutic approach to lower FGF23 and improve bone and cardiac health in CKD. | Corey Dussold Claire Gerber Samantha White Xueyan Wang Lixin Qi Connor Francis Maralee Capella Guillaume Courbon Jingya Wang Chaoyuan Li Jian Q. | 7 | Scientific evidence is just the starting point: A generalizable process for developing sports injury prevention interventions显示文摘Background: The 2 most cited sports injury prevention research frameworks incorporate intervention development, yet little guidance is available in the sports science literature on how to undertake this complex process. This paper presents a generalizable process for developing implementable sports injury prevention interventions, including a case study applying the process to develop a lower limb injury prevention exercise training program(Footy First) for community Australian football.Methods: The intervention development process is underpinned by 2 complementary premises:(1) that evidence-based practice integrates the best available scientific evidence with practitioner expertise and end user values and(2) that research evidence alone is insufficient to develop implementable interventions.Results: The generalizable 6-step intervention development process involves(1) compiling research evidence, clinical experience, and knowledge of the implementation context;(2) consulting with experts;(3) engaging with end users;(4) testing the intervention;(5) using theory; and(6)obtaining feedback from early implementers. Following each step, intervention content and presentation should be revised to ensure that the final intervention includes evidence-informed content that is likely to be adopted, properly implemented, and sustained over time by the targeted intervention deliverers. For Footy First, this process involved establishing a multidisciplinary intervention development group, conducting 2targeted literature reviews, undertaking an online expert consensus process, conducting focus groups with program end users, testing the program multiple times in different contexts, and obtaining feedback from early implementers of the program.Conclusion: This systematic yet pragmatic and iterative intervention development process is potentially applicable to any injury prevention topic across all sports settings and levels. It will guide researchers wishing to undertake intervention development. | Alex Donaldson David G.Lloyd Belinda J.Gabbe Jill Cook Warren Young Peta White Caroline F.Finch | 2016 | Journal of Sport and Health Science2016,5,3: | 3 |

Saltwater intrusion and water management in coastal wetlands显示文摘Coastal wetlands perform a unique set of physical,chemical,and biological functions,which provide billions of dollars of ecosystem services annually.These wetlands also face myriad environmental and anthropogenic pressures,which threaten their ecological condition and undermine their capacity to provide these services.Coastal wetlands have adapted to a dynamic range of natural disturbances over recent millennia,but face growing pressures from human population growth and coastal development.These anthropogenic pressures are driving saltwater intrusion(SWI)in many coastal systems.The position of coastal wetlands at the terrestrial-marine interface also makes them vulnerable to increasing rates of sealevel rise and changing climate.Critically,anthropogenic and natural stressors to coastal wetlands can act synergistically to create negative,and sometimes catastrophic,consequences for both human and natural systems.This review focused on the drivers and impacts of SWI in coastal wetlands and has two goals:(1)to synthesize understanding of coastal wetland change driven by SWI and(2)to review approaches for improved water management to mitigate SWI in impacted systems.While we frame this review as a choice between restoration and retreat,we acknowledge that choices about coastal wetland management are context-specific and may be confounded by competing management goals.In this setting,the choice between restoration and retreat can be prioritized by identifying where the greatest return in ecosystem services can be achieved relative to restoration dollars invested.We conclude that restoration and proactive water management is feasible in many impacted systems. | Elliott White,Jr. David Kaplan | 2017 | Ecosystem Health and Sustainability2017,3,1: | 2 |
